New PM Andy Burnham cuts tax on household electricity bills

The Treasury confirmed that new Prime Minister Andy Burnham has scrapped the 5% tax on household electricity bills from 1 October 2026. That tax had applied across the whole UK since 1997. The Independent called it his first big policy move. Downing Street said it gives households "breathing space on cost of living."
